#1e6446 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e6446 is composed of 11.8% red, 39.2% green and 27.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70% cyan, 0% magenta, 30%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 154.3 degrees, a saturation of 53.8% and a lightness of 25.5%. #1e6446 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cc88c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1e6446 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1e6446 has RGB values of R:30, G:100, B:70 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0, Y:0.3,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 1991750.
